3. And be it enacted, That said corporation shall be capable of
receiving from any free person or persons, any deposit or deposits.
of money, and that all monies received, or to be received, shall be
vested in public stocks, or other securities, and such interest be al-
lowed to the depositors thereof as may from time to time be direct-
ed or provided for. by the by-laws of said corporation; the surplus
profits to be divided every three years among the depositors, in
such manner as the directors for the time being may think proper;
and that no member shall be liable in his person or property for
any debts, contracts or engagements, of the said corporation, but
that the money, property, rights and credits, of said corporation,
and nothing more, shall be liable for the same.
4. And be it enacted, That the, directors of said corporation, or
a majority of thorn: attending at any meeting of the board, may
elect, by ballot, any other person or persons as members of the
Savings Bank of Baltimore.

Passed Jan 29 1819

CHAPTER 94.
' An act for the relief of Phebe Cresap, of Allegany county.
Sec. 1. Be it enacted, by the General Assembly of Maryland, That
the said Phebe Cresap be and she is hereby divorced from bed,
board, and mutual cohabitation, with her husband John M. Cresap.
2. And be it enacted, That all the right and title which the said
John M. Cresap, by virtue of his marriage with said Phebe, had
acquired to any property which she now is or may become entitled
to, in any way or manner whatever, be and the same is hereby an-
nulled and made, void, and that the said Phebe be and she is hereby
declared, capable to have, hold, take, receive, sue for, and reco-
ver, by compromise, suit or suits in law or equity, all such proper-
ty, in as full and ample a manner as if she were a feme sole, and
had never been married; and to hold, use, and enjoy the same, for
her own use. and benefit, and the same to dispose of according to
her will and pleasure, without the molestation, interference, hin-
derance or consent, of her said husband, in the same manner she
could or might have done were she a feme sole.

Passed Jan 30 1819

CHAPTER 95.

An act authorising Aquilla G. Bowen, late one of the Col-
lectors of Calvert county, to complete his Collections.
Sec. 1. Be it enacted, by the General Assembly of Maryland,
That. Aquilla G. Bowen, late one of the collectors of Calvert coun-
ty, be and he is hereby empowered to proceed, (as heretofore an-
thorised,) to complete his collections in Calvert county, until the
first day of January eighteen hundred and twenty.
